Uganda - Export of Personal Weighing Machines, Baby and Household Scales

Since 2014, Uganda Export of Personal Weighing Machines, Baby and Household Scales decreased by 38.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 110 comparing other countries in Export of Personal Weighing Machines, Baby and Household Scales with $277.87. Uganda is overtaken by Madagascar, which was number 109 at $284.17 and is followed by Macedonia with $229.65. China lead the ranking with $628,263,160.55 in 2019, +2.2% versus 2018. Germany, Netherlands and United Kingdom resp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ivory Coast witnessed the best average annual growth at +223.5% per year, while Morocco was the worst growing country at -74.4% per year.
